From Santiago Bernabéu to Santo Domingo-Caudilla by bus and metro
To get from Santiago Bernabéu to Santo Domingo-Caudilla in Madrid, take the M-10 metro from Santiago Bernabéu station to Príncipe Pío station. Next, take the VAC082 bus from Intercambiador De Príncipe Pío station to C. Trampa (Alcabón), Val De Santo Domingo station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 49 min. The ride fare is €7.57.
